[f16-branch 1/2] LANG_DEFAULT lives in lang.c.

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Related: rhbz#731356
---
 loader/lang.c   |    4 +++-
 loader/lang.h   |    4 +++-
 loader/loader.c |    3 +--
 3 files changed, 7 insertions(+), 4 deletions(-)

diff --git a/loader/lang.c b/loader/lang.c
index 24878a7..6b1fa8e 100644
--- a/loader/lang.c
+++ b/loader/lang.c
@@ -47,6 +47,8 @@
 #include "../pyanaconda/isys/isys.h"
 #include "../pyanaconda/isys/log.h"
 
+const char *LANG_DEFAULT = "en_US.UTF-8";
+
 /* boot flags */
 extern uint64_t flags;
 
@@ -368,7 +370,7 @@ static char * getLangNick(char * oldLang) {
     return lang;
 }
 
-int setLanguage (char * key, int forced) {
+int setLanguage (const char * key, int forced) {
     int i;
 
     if (!languages) loadLanguageList();
diff --git a/loader/lang.h b/loader/lang.h
index d4b61dd..168ffa3 100644
--- a/loader/lang.h
+++ b/loader/lang.h
@@ -32,7 +32,9 @@ struct langInfo {
 
 int chooseLanguage(char ** lang);
 char * translateString(char * str);
-int setLanguage (char * key, int forced);
+int setLanguage (const char * key, int forced);
 int getLangInfo(struct langInfo **langs);
 
+extern const char *LANG_DEFAULT;
+
 #endif /* _LANG_H_ */
diff --git a/loader/loader.c b/loader/loader.c
index 2c5eb51..eedf439 100644
--- a/loader/loader.c
+++ b/loader/loader.c
@@ -128,7 +128,6 @@ int num_link_checks = 5;
 int post_link_sleep = 0;
 
 static int init_sig = SIGUSR1; /* default to shutdown=halt */
-static const char *LANG_DEFAULT = "en_US.UTF-8";
 
 static char *VIRTIO_PORT = "/dev/virtio-ports/org.fedoraproject.anaconda.log.0";
 
@@ -2059,7 +2058,7 @@ int main(int argc, char ** argv) {
     if (loaderData.lang && loaderData.lang_set == 1) {
         setLanguage(loaderData.lang, 1);
     } else {
-        setLanguage("en_US.UTF-8", 1);
+        setLanguage(LANG_DEFAULT, 1);
     }
 
     /* FIXME: this is a bit of a hack */
-- 
1.7.6.4

_______________________________________________
Anaconda-devel-list mailing list
Anaconda-devel-list@xxxxxxxxxx
https://www.redhat.com/mailman/listinfo/anaconda-devel-list


[Index of Archives]     [Kickstart]     [Fedora Users]     [Fedora Legacy List]     [Fedora Maintainers]     [Fedora Desktop]     [Fedora SELinux]     [Big List of Linux Books]     [Yosemite News]     [Yosemite Photos]     [KDE Users]     [Fedora Tools]
  Powered by Linux